What Are PRP Treatments and How They Support Hair Growth
Platelet-rich plasma therapy has become one of the most studied regenerative approaches for hair restoration over the past decade. We extract a small sample of your blood, centrifuge it to concentrate platelets and growth factors, and inject the resulting plasma directly into areas experiencing hair thinning or loss.
PRP works through a straightforward biological mechanism: platelets contain dozens of growth factors including platelet-derived growth factor (PDGF), vascular endothelial growth factor (VEGF), and transforming growth factor-beta (TGF-β). When introduced into the scalp, these factors stimulate dormant hair follicles, improve blood circulation to follicles, and reduce inflammation in the hair-bearing tissue. The process essentially “wakes up” miniaturized follicles that haven’t fully entered the resting phase.
Clinical evidence supports PRP’s effectiveness, particularly for androgenetic alopecia (pattern hair loss). Patients typically see results within 3-4 months, with optimal outcomes visible around 6-9 months post-treatment. We usually recommend a series of 3-4 sessions spaced 4-6 weeks apart, followed by maintenance treatments every 6-12 months. When combined with complementary approaches like PRP hair restoration protocols, the response rate improves significantly.
The appeal of PRP lies in its autologous nature (using your own blood) and relative safety profile. However, one limitation is the variability in platelet concentration and growth factor density depending on your baseline blood composition and the processing technique used.

The Evolution of Exosome Therapy for Hair Restoration
Exosomes represent a newer frontier in regenerative medicine, and they’re transforming how we approach cellular signaling at the hair follicle level. These are tiny extracellular vesicles, measuring 30-150 nanometers, that cells naturally secrete as packages of proteins, lipids, RNA, and other bioactive molecules. Think of them as sophisticated cellular communication tools that transfer information between cells.
In hair restoration, we use exosomes derived from mesenchymal stem cells or other regenerative sources. Unlike PRP, which relies on growth factors floating freely in plasma, exosomes deliver their payload of signaling molecules directly inside recipient cells. This intracellular delivery creates a more targeted and sustained regenerative response.
The science behind exosome therapy for hair is elegant: exosomes contain microRNAs and proteins that suppress the inflammatory pathways driving follicle miniaturization, promote angiogenesis (new blood vessel formation), and stimulate the proliferation of hair follicle stem cells. Because exosomes work at the genetic expression level, the effects tend to be more durable and comprehensive than PRP alone.
Research published over the past three years demonstrates that exosome-treated hair follicles show increased thickness, extended growth phase duration, and improved survival rates compared to untreated controls. Patients typically observe initial regrowth within 2-3 months, with continued improvement through month 12.

Key Differences Between Exosomes and PRP for Hair Loss

The distinction between these two therapies extends far beyond marketing language. Understanding the actual biological differences helps you make an informed choice about which approach aligns with your hair loss severity and timeline.
Mechanism of Action: PRP delivers growth factors into the extracellular space where they bind to cell surface receptors. Exosomes enter cells directly and alter gene expression from within. This means exosomes can influence cellular behavior at a more fundamental level than PRP.
Longevity of Effect: PRP growth factors are gradually diluted and broken down over weeks to months. Exosome effects can persist longer because they establish changes in cellular signaling pathways that continue producing results even after the initial exosomes are metabolized.
Follicle Regeneration Depth: PRP excels at stimulating existing dormant follicles that still have viable stem cells. Exosomes can regenerate follicles across a broader spectrum of damage because they work through multiple signaling pathways simultaneously.
Variability: PRP quality depends entirely on your blood composition, age, and overall health. Exosomes produced from standardized stem cell sources offer more consistent potency from treatment to treatment.
Timeline to Results: Both show early response within 3-4 months, but exosomes tend to demonstrate more robust results by months 6-9 due to their sustained signaling effects.
Treatment Frequency: PRP typically requires quarterly maintenance. Exosome protocols often space treatments further apart because the effects persist longer.
